The Anatomy of an Effective Creative Artist Business Card

Creating a truly memorable business card requires more than just slapping your name and contact information onto a piece of paper. It demands careful consideration of several key elements that work together to create a cohesive and impactful representation of your brand. Let’s break down the critical components:

1. Design Concept: Reflecting Your Artistic Style

Your business card should be an extension of your artistic style. Are you a minimalist painter? A bold graphic designer? A whimsical sculptor? The design of your card should immediately communicate your aesthetic. Consider using:

  • Color Palette: Choose colors that are consistent with your artwork and brand identity.
  • Typography: Select fonts that complement your style and are easy to read. A handwritten font might suit a calligrapher, while a modern sans-serif could work for a digital artist.
  • Imagery: Incorporate a miniature version of your artwork, a logo, or a unique graphic element that represents your brand.

2. Essential Information: Clarity and Conciseness

While creativity is key, your business card must also provide essential information in a clear and concise manner. Include:

  • Your Name: Make it prominent and easy to read.
  • Your Title (Optional): Artist, Designer, Photographer, etc.
  • Contact Information: Phone number, email address, website, and social media handles.
  • Address (Optional): If you have a physical studio or gallery, include your address.

3. Material and Printing: Elevating the Experience

The material and printing techniques you choose can significantly impact the overall feel and perceived quality of your business card. Consider:

  • Paper Stock: Opt for a high-quality paper stock that feels substantial and luxurious. Consider textured paper, recycled paper, or even specialty materials like wood or metal.
  • Printing Techniques: Explore options like letterpress, foil stamping, embossing, or die-cutting to add a unique and tactile element to your card.
  • Shape and Size: While standard business card sizes are common, don’t be afraid to experiment with unique shapes and sizes to stand out from the crowd.

Choosing the Right Printing Service: Quality and Expertise Matter

Selecting the right printing service is crucial to ensuring that your creative artist business cards are produced to the highest standards. Look for a printer that specializes in high-quality printing and has experience working with artists and designers. Consider these factors:

  • Printing Quality: Request samples of their work to assess the quality of their printing. Pay attention to color accuracy, sharpness, and overall finish.
  • Material Options: Choose a printer that offers a wide variety of paper stocks and printing techniques to suit your design needs.
  • Customer Service: Look for a printer that provides excellent customer service and is responsive to your questions and concerns.
  • Pricing: Obtain quotes from multiple printers to compare pricing and ensure that you are getting a fair price for the quality of work.

Many online printing services offer affordable options, but be sure to carefully review their quality and reputation before placing an order. Local print shops often provide more personalized service and can offer expert advice on design and printing techniques.

Vistaprint Business Cards: A Comprehensive Review

Vistaprint offers a compelling option for creating creative artist business cards, balancing affordability with a degree of customization. However, it’s essential to approach their services with a balanced perspective, understanding both their strengths and limitations.

User Experience & Usability

The Vistaprint website is generally user-friendly, with a straightforward design process. The online design tool is relatively intuitive, allowing users to upload their own designs or customize existing templates. However, the sheer number of templates can be overwhelming, and finding the right one can take time. In our experience, the drag-and-drop interface is functional but can sometimes feel clunky.

Performance & Effectiveness

Vistaprint’s printing quality is generally good for the price. Colors are usually accurate, and the print resolution is acceptable for most designs. However, the quality of the paper stock can vary, and the standard options may feel thin and flimsy. For a more premium feel, upgrading to a thicker paper stock is recommended. We’ve observed that cards with simpler designs tend to print more consistently than those with intricate details or gradients.
